TOP Chinese business and technology officials visited the University of Essex.

The delegation which arrived from the Jiangsu Province, included the vice president at Jiangsu Industrial Technology Research Institute He Liwen, president at Robotics and Intelligent Equipment Institute Wang Rong Chuan and the vice president at Institute of Jiangnan University Shan Liang amongst many more.

Essex County Council's trade team Essex International co-ordinated the trip, and the officials were accompanied by Peter Manning from the organisation.

Whilst in the country they had the chance to see some of the state-of-the-art facilities at the Colchester campus including the Bloomberg trading floor in the Essex Business School, research laboratories in the School of Computer Science and Electronic Engineering and Parkside Office Village on the Knowledge Gateway research and technology park.

University vice-chancellor professor Anthony Forster has previously visited Northwest University in China.

He said: "We were delighted to have the chance to talk to business leaders from China who are working across a number of technological fields which are also strengths at the university including data analytics, robotics, intelligent systems and artificial intelligence.

"Essex International is helping us build strong links with Chinese entrepreneurs and the Jiangsu Provincial Government.

"We are confident these connections will lead to new partnerships which will take forward our international mission to deliver excellence in research and excellence in education."
